Barcelona set to offer Andre Gomes to sign N’Golo Kante

Rishabh Gupta
Published

The French star is set to be lead the summer transfer saga.

Barcelona have completed their second signing of the summer yesterday, as Clement Lenglet finally arrived at Camp Nou. But it seems like the Catalan club doesn’t want to rest as they are now pursuing Chelsea’s top midfielder and one of their key members in 2016-17 title winning campaign, N’Golo Kante.

Kante arrived at Chelsea in 2016, after an incredible season with Leicester City where the club won the league title. Ever since, N’Golo Kante has been the most pivotal midfielder for the Blues. However, many reports claim that Barcelona are now eyeing the French midfielder.

Expert transfer journalist Gianluca Di Marzio stated that Barcelona wants to sign Kante, and are even willing to offer Andre Gomes as a part of the deal. Andre Gomes’ contract with Barcelona expires in 2021, and has a release clause of €97m.

Chelsea, on the other hand, are said consider Barcelona’s offer due to the impending arrival of Jorginho, who has been one of the major transfer targets for Pep Guardiola’s Barcelona.

Kante is currently with French national team, and is set to play for the trophy when France meets Croatia in the World Cup final on Sunday.

Daily Express also reports that Barcelona sees Kante as an effective midfielder and will strengthen Barca’s squad as the club eyes for Champions League glory next season. According to English outlet, Barcelona will offer the French midfielder €225,000/week.

Earlier, Barcelona completed the signing of Brazilian midfielder Arthur Melo from Gremio. After months of speculation, Barcelona also reached the deal for the signing of Sevilla defender Clement Lenglet.
